We don't treat sewage cleanup as a single generic task — each part of the process below gets its own specific approach.

Water gets classified as Category 3 blackwater on arrival, which sets the entire response protocol.
We extract with full PPE and controlled disposal of extracted contaminated water.
Carpet, pad, and drywall that contacted blackwater almost always require removal rather than drying in place.
Every surface that had contact with contaminated water gets disinfected with hospital-grade antimicrobial treatment.
We address the contamination causing the odor rather than just deploying an air freshener.
Final verification includes both moisture and contamination checks before sign-off.
